About
Covenant House is a non-profit agency providing crisis care, food, shelter, clothing, medical services, counseling, transitional living, substance abuse prevention and treatment, mental health services, educational opportunities, vocational training and other services to homeless youth under 21 years of age. Faith Community is a full time volunteer program where individuals can spend 3 months, 6 months, or 12 months serving the youth of Covenant House. College degree or relevent work experience is needed . Our volunteers receive room and board, medical coverage, and a small weekly stipend. Covenant Houses that currently have a Faith Community are New York, NY; Atlantic City, NJ; Ft. Lauderdale, FL.
Mission: COVENANT HOUSE MISSION STATEMENT We who recognize God's providence and fidelity to God's people are dedicated to living out a covenant among ourselves and those children we serve, with absolute respect and unconditional love. That commitment calls us to serve suffering children of the street,and to protect and safeguard all children.Just as Christ in his humanity is the visible sign of God's presence among the people, our efforts together in the covenant communityare a visible sign that effects the presence of God,working through the Holy Spirit among ourselves and our kids.
